65W vs 100W: same voltage, more current.
Both sit on the 20V rail; 100W simply pushes 5A where 65W pushes 3.25A. That has two consequences — it covers a MacBook Pro 14″, and it demands an e-marked 5A cable before it will do so.
Spec sheet, side by side
| 65W | 100W | |
|---|---|---|
| Top rail | 20V/3.25A | 20V/5A — the PD 3.0 ceiling |
| Cable required | 3A cable works, 5A recommended | 5A e-marked cable, no exceptions |
| Ports | 2–3 typical | 3–4 typical |
| Size class | Golf-ball GaN cube, folding plug | Noticeably larger, often non-folding |
| Two-device behaviour | Roughly 45W + 20W | Roughly 65W + 30W |
| Best-suited devices | MacBook Air, XPS, ThinkPad, phones | + MacBook Pro 14″, docked handhelds, multi-device desks |
100W is the top of PD 3.0. Everything above it — 140W, 240W — requires PD 3.1 and different voltages, which is why 100W is a natural stopping point rather than an arbitrary one. See 100W vs 140W for what happens past this line.
Where each one wins
65W wins for travel and for single-laptop users. The folding plug and the smaller body matter every day; the extra 35W matters only when a second or third device is attached. A MacBook Air, an XPS 13 or a ThinkPad X-series will never ask for more than 65W.
100W wins on desks and on Pro laptops. A MacBook Pro 14″ ships with 67W or 96W depending on configuration, so 100W is the third-party equivalent with a margin. It is also the point where four-port units become common, meaning a laptop at 65W and three accessories sharing the remaining 35W without the laptop dropping a rail. Verdict: 65W for one laptop, 100W for a desk
If you carry one ultrabook and a phone, buy 65W: it delivers every watt those devices request, it folds flat, and it is the better watts-per-dollar tier. If a MacBook Pro 14″, a docked gaming handheld, or three simultaneous devices are in the picture, buy 100W — the shared budget is the real feature, not the headline number. The tie-breaker for people genuinely on the fence is Apple's 70W class, which adds fast-charging for a MacBook Air without the bulk of a 100W unit. FAQ
Will a 100W charger charge my MacBook Air faster than a 65W one?
Only up to the machine's own limit. M-series MacBook Airs fast-charge at 70W on the models that support it, so anything at or above 70W is the same speed. Below that, 65W is normal-speed charging.
Do I need a special cable for 100W?
Yes. Sustained output above 60W requires a 5A e-marked cable. Without one the link negotiates down to 60W regardless of what the adapter can supply.
Is a 100W adapter overkill for a phone?
Not harmful, just unnecessary in isolation — the phone still draws about 20 to 27W. On a multi-port 100W unit, though, the extra budget is what keeps the phone at full speed while a laptop is attached.
